Disclosed is a sensor device in which the vibration efficiency is not lowered. In the case of a spring-mass model in which a vibration sensor element is regarded as a mass body and a die-bond material is regarded as an elastic body, when the resonant frequency of the model approaches the vibrational frequency of a vibrator, the original vibration of the vibrator is inhibited. Specifically disclosed is a sensor device provided with a case (41), a vibration sensor element (10) which is mounted on the case (41) and provided therein with a vibrator, the vibration direction of which is parallel to a surface mounted on the case, and a die-bond material (31) disposed between the case (41) and the vibration sensor element (10), the sensor device being characterized in that when the vibrational frequency of the vibrator is f1, the mass of the vibration sensor element is M, the bond area of the die-bond material is S, the thickness thereof is d, and the transverse elastic coefficient thereof is G, a predetermined formula is satisfied.
